Throughout human history, people have used celestial objects such as the stars, moon, sun, and planets for a variety of purposes. Here are some examples:

Navigation: Sailors and travelers have used the stars, moon, and sun to help navigate the seas and lands for thousands of years. By observing the positions of celestial objects, they can determine their location, direction, and even the time of day.

Agriculture: Farmers have used the cycles of the moon and the seasons of the year to determine when to plant and harvest their crops. The rising and setting positions of the sun have also been used to tell time and measure the length of the day.

Astronomy: Astronomers have studied the stars, moon, sun, and planets to learn more about the universe and our place in it. They have used this knowledge to better understand the motions and behavior of celestial objects and to make predictions about eclipses, comet sightings, and other astronomical events.

Mythology and Religion: In many cultures, celestial objects have been associated with gods, goddesses, and other spiritual beings. People have used these stories to explain natural phenomena and to give meaning to their world.

Art and Literature: Celestial objects have inspired artists and writers for centuries. From the paintings of the night sky by Vincent van Gogh to the epic poem "The Iliad" by Homer, celestial objects have been a source of inspiration and creative expression.

The humid continental climate region is located in the middle and eastern parts of North America, stretching from central Canada to the eastern United States. This climate region is characterized by four distinct seasons, with warm summers and cold winters. The region experiences high levels of precipitation throughout the year, with a peak in the summer months. Additionally, this climate region experiences moderate to high humidity, with frequent cloud cover and fog.

In the grassland ecosystem, which is found within the humid continental climate region, two common plant species are big bluestem and Indian grass. Both of these species are tall grasses that grow in dense clumps, providing important habitat and food sources for various animals.

Two common animal species found in the grassland ecosystem are the pronghorn antelope and the American bison. The pronghorn antelope is a fast-running herbivore that feeds on the tall grasses in the grassland. The American bison, also known as the buffalo, is a large herbivore that plays a crucial role in maintaining the grassland ecosystem by grazing on the grasses and fertilizing the soil with their waste.

What relationship does the French Revolution have with the independence of Latin American countries?

The French Revolution served as an inspiration for Latin American intellectuals, because they were inspired by the ideas of a new system of government to rebel against the Spanish crown.

What relationship do the Napoleonic wars have with the independence of the Latin American countries?

The Napoleonic wars were important for the independence of the countries of Latin America because during the Napoleonic wars the French invaded Spain causing a weakening of the Spanish institutions that lost control over their colonies and this allowed the revolutionary armies to achieve independence.

During the apartheid era, curriculum development in south African education was rigidly centralised. While each distinct department had its own curriculum development and protocols, at least in theory, in South Africa, curriculum development was largely controlled by committees affiliated with the white House of Assembly. Authoritarianism, rote learning, and corporal punishment were the norm because of how prescriptive this system was, which was supported on the one hand by a network of inspectors and subject advisors and on the other by numerous generations of subpar teachers. These problems were made worse in the deplorable settings of schools for children of colour. There was very little room for teachers to set standards or evaluate student work, and examination criteria and procedures were used to advance the political viewpoints of those in authority. The similarities and differences in the speech

The "Niagara Movement Speech" by W.E.B Du Bois and the "Speech before the Atlanta Cotton States and International Exposition" by Booker T. Washington are both significant speeches in American history. They were delivered during a time when the African American community was seeking equal rights and seeking a way to end the racial oppression that was prevalent in the United States.

The two speeches are alike in that they both address the issues of racial equality and the need for African Americans to have equal opportunities in society. Both speakers emphasized the importance of education and hard work as a means of achieving their goals.

However, the two speeches are also different in their approach and tone. Du Bois was a leader of the Niagara Movement, which was an organization that advocated for civil rights and the end of segregation. His speech was more aggressive in tone and called for immediate action to end the injustices faced by African Americans. In contrast, Washington's speech was more conciliatory in tone and emphasized the importance of education and economic progress as a means of achieving equal rights.

The speeches by Du Bois and Washington had a significant impact on the African American community and the wider society. Du Bois's speech helped to galvanize the civil rights movement and set the stage for future activism, while Washington's speech helped to establish the Tuskegee Institute as a leading institution of higher learning for African Americans.

The Poisson distribution is a probability distribution that describes the number of events that occur in a fixed interval of time or space, given the average rate of occurrence.

It is named after the French mathematician Siméon Denis Poisson, who first introduced the distribution in 1837 in his study of the number of deaths by accidental horse kicks in the Prussian army.

The Poisson distribution is used in a wide range of fields, including biology, physics, economics, and criminology, to model random processes that involve rare events. The distribution was also used by Sherman, Gartin, and Buergner in their study of the randomness of crime.

I really do appreciate you :) Forensic entomologists use their knowledge of insects and and their life cycles and behaviors to give them clues about a crime. Most insects used in forensic investigations are in two major orders: Diptera (flies) and Coleoptera (beetles).Species succession may provide clues for investigators. Some insect species may feed on a fresh corpse, while another species may prefer to feed on one that has been dead for two weeks. Other insect species that prey on the insects feeding on the corpse may also be found.Weather data is also an important tool in analyzing insect evidence from a corpse. Investigators will make note of the temperature of the air, ground surface, the interface area between the body and the ground, and the soil under the body as well as the temperature inside any maggot masses. They will also collect weather data related to daily temperature (highs/lows) and precipitation for a period of time before the body was discovered to the day the insect evidence was collected.1.
